CHINESE GINGER FRIED RICE WITH HOISIN GLAZED TOFU



Chinese Ginger Fried Rice with Hoisin Glazed Tofu image

Yield Serves 3

Number Of Ingredients 20

1/2 brown onion, thinly sliced
2 tsp finely grated ginger
1 clove garlic, minced
1 carrot, grated
1 pack Chinese rice spices
1 pack frozen peas
1 pack pre-cooked rice
1 Tbsp soy sauce
2 tsp sesame oil
2 tsp vinegar
1 pack tofu, diced 1cm
1 Tbsp cornflour
1/2 pack hoisin glaze
1 bunch coriander, leaves picked
1 spring onion, thinly sliced
1/2 pack mixed baby leaf lettuce
Remaining hoisin glaze
1 pack mung bean sprouts
1 pack sesame seeds
Pinch of garlic chilli blend (optional)

Steps:

  • Steps Prep veggies. Cook fried rice. Heat a drizzle of oil in a fry-pan on medium-high heat. Cook onion for 2 minutes, until softened. Add ginger, garlic and Chinese rice spices and cook for 1 minute, until fragrant. Add carrot, peas and rice to pan and cook for 3-4 minutes, until rice is warmed through and peas are tender. Stir through soy sauce, sesame oil and vinegar. Season to taste and cover to keep warm. Prep & cook tofu. Toss tofu in a bowl with cornflour and 1/2 tsp salt. Heat a drizzle of oil in a non-stick fry-pan on high heat. Cook tofu for 6-8 minutes, tossing every few minutes, until golden brown and crisp all over. Add first measure of hoisin glaze to pan and toss to coat tofu. Prep coriander & spring onion. Serve fried rice and lettuce with tofu and remaining hoisin glaze. Top with remaining garnishes.

GINGER FRIED RICE



Ginger Fried Rice image

A simple fried rice recipe full of the delicate flavor of ginger, the perfect accompaniment to any Asian meal.

Provided by SunnyDaysNora

Categories     Main Dish Recipes     Rice     Fried Rice Recipes

Time 20m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 12

½ cup olive oil, divided
1 cup sliced green onions
1 cup shredded carrots
4 eggs, lightly beaten
¼ cup ginger paste
2 tablespoons minced garlic
½ teaspoon salt
4 cups day-old cooked white rice
¼ cup soy sauce
1 tablespoon oyster sauce
2 teaspoons Sriracha sauce
½ teaspoon sesame oil

Steps:

  • Heat 1/4 cup olive oil in large skillet over medium heat. Add green onions, shredded carrots, eggs, ginger paste, minced garlic, and salt. Stir gently until eggs are cooked through, 4 to 5 minutes. Transfer to a bowl.
  • Pour remaining 1/4 cup into the same skillet and add rice. Fry for 2 minutes. Add soy sauce, oyster sauce, Sriracha sauce, and sesame oil; stir to combine. Add egg mixture back into the skillet and stir gently to combine. Cook for 2 minutes more.

GINGER CHICKEN FRIED RICE



Ginger Chicken Fried Rice image

Make and share this Ginger Chicken Fried Rice recipe from Food.com.

Provided by threeovens

Categories     One Dish Meal

Time 45m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 small onion, chopped
2 tablespoons canola oil, divided
2 eggs, lightly beaten
1 lb boneless skinless chicken breast, cut into 1/2 inch cubes
2 tablespoons ginger, minced
2 garlic cloves, minced
1/2 cup green onion, chopped
1 red bell pepper, cut into 1/4 inch dice
4 cups rice, cooked (brown or white)
1 cup peas, thawed if frozen
3 tablespoons soy sauce
1 teaspoon sesame oil

Steps:

  • Heat a large skillet over medium high heat. Add 1 teaspoon oil and onions, cook until onions begin to brown around the edges, about 7 minutes. Add eggs and cook until set, about 2 minutes; set aside. Add 1 tablespoon oil, add chicken and cook until lightly browned, stirring occasionally, about 5 or 6 minutes; set aside with eggs.
  • Add remaining oil to the skillet and cook the ginger, garlic, and red pepper until softened, about 2 minutes. Add rice and peas, cook an additional 2 minutes.
  • Stir in eggs, chicken, soy sauce and sesame oil. Cook until heated through, about 3 to 5 minutes. Sprinkle with green onions and serve.

SOY AND GINGER GLAZED TOFU



Soy and Ginger Glazed Tofu image

I love tofu...I like how it picks up the flavor of whatever sauce it's coated with. I especially liked this recipe where the tofu is browned a bit before having the sauce poured on top. This can be served warm or at room temperature. It would be a good addition to a bento box (Japanese boxed lunch). I found this gem in the Chicago Tribune, which attributes it to Ron Bilaro.

Provided by Hey Jude

Categories     Lunch/Snacks

Time 46m

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 1/2 teaspoons cornstarch
1 tablespoon water
2 tablespoons rice wine vinegar
1 tablespoon reduced sodium soy sauce
1 tablespoon sesame oil
1 inch piece fresh gingerroot, grated
1 garlic clove, minced
1 (14 ounce) package firm tofu, drained
1 green onion, chopped (white and some green)

Steps:

  • Stir cornstarch into water in a small bowl until dissolved; set aside. Heat vinegar, soy sauce and sesame oil in a small saucepan over medium heat; whisk dissolved cornstarch into the soy mixture. Cook, whisking, until mixture starts to thicken, about 20 seconds. Remove from heat and stir in ginger and garlic. Set aside.
  • Spray a large skillet with cooking spray; heat over high heat. Add tofu and cook, turning turning several times, until all four sides of the block are beginning to brown, about 2 minutes each side. Set aside for 2 minutes and then slice into 6 slices. Transfer to a platter and pour soy mixture over slices, then garnish with the chopped green onions.
  • You can slice and brown the tofu any way that you prefer -- cut it into logs, blocks or even little bunny shapes if that's what you like!

GINGER FRIED RICE



Ginger Fried Rice image

For variety and color, I like to combine at least two types of vegetables in this fried rice recipe. It's a flexible dish, limited only by what's in the fridge and your imagination. -Becky Matheny, Strasburg, Virginia

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Side Dishes

Time 25m

Yield 2 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 teaspoons canola oil, divided
1 egg, lightly beaten
1/4 cup chopped sweet red pepper
1 tablespoon chopped green onion
1 garlic clove, minced
1 cup cold cooked instant rice
1/4 cup cubed cooked chicken
1 to 2 tablespoons soy sauce
1/2 teaspoon ground ginger
1 tablespoon shredded carrot

Steps:

  • In a large skillet, heat 1 teaspoon oil over medium-high heat. Pour egg into skillet. As egg sets, lift edges, letting uncooked portion flow underneath. When egg is completely cooked, remove to plate. Set aside., In the same skillet, saute pepper and onion in remaining oil until tender. Add garlic; cook 1 minute longer. Stir in the rice, chicken, soy sauce and ginger. Chop egg into small pieces; stir into skillet and heat through. Garnish with carrot.

TOFU FRIED RICE (FROM COOKING LIGHT)



Tofu Fried Rice (from Cooking Light) image

A superfast and healthy recipe, one of the greatest hits from the Sept 2004 issue of Cooking Light. The flavors are very mild and the dish is a good way to add some tofu to your diet. I've also made this with lean boneless pork or chicken. I think instant rice is an abomination so I take a little extra time to make the real thing.

Provided by LonghornMama

Categories     Rice

Time 20m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 cups uncooked instant rice
2 tablespoons vegetable oil, divided
1 (14 ounce) package reduced-fat firm tofu, drained and cut into 1/2 inch cubes
2 large eggs, lightly beaten
1 cup green onion, in 1/2 inch slices
1 cup frozen peas and carrot, thawed
2 teaspoons bottled minced garlic
1 teaspoon bottled minced fresh ginger
2 tablespoons sake (rice wine) or 1 tablespoon rice wine vinegar
3 tablespoons low sodium soy sauce
1 tablespoon hoisin sauce
1/2 teaspoon dark sesame oil
thinly sliced green onion (optional)

Steps:

  • Cook rice according to package directions, omitting salt and fat.
  • While rice cooks, heat 1 T vegetable oil in a large nonstick skillet over medium-high heat.
  • Add tofu; cook 4 minutes or until lightly browned, stirring occasionally.
  • Remove from pan.
  • Add eggs to pan; cook 1 minute or until done, breaking eggs into small pieces.
  • Remove from pan.
  • Add 1 T vegetable oil to pan.
  • Add 1 c onions, peas and carrots, garlic and ginger; saute 2 minutes.
  • While vegetable mixture cooks, combine sake, soy sauce, hoisin sauce, and sesame oil.
  • Add cooked rice to pan; cook 2 minutes, stirring constantly.
  • Add tofu, egg and soy sauce mixture; cook 30 seconds, stirring constantly.
  • Garnish with sliced green onions if desired.
